TGS: Ninja Gaiden 3 announced in Tokyo

ninjagaiden3

Tecmo Koei's announced Ninja Gaiden 3 at a behind-closed-doors event in Tokyo.

Team Ninja will once again handle dev duties on this, the first title in the series since series creator Tomonobu Itagaki left the company.

Not much was revealed as to what to expect from the sequel, but it's thought we're going to see a "more human side" to main character Ryu.

According to Videogamer, we're also going to see a more violent Ryu as well, with a "decent into a hellish realm".

No date or platforms were announced by TK.

The last Ninja Gaiden, Ninja Gaiden II, was released in June 2008 for Xbox 360, before getting a later release on PS3.
